Pro Tips

Don't rely solely on standard blood tests for magnesium; serum levels can appear normal even with intracellular deficiency. Focus on symptoms like muscle cramps, poor sleep, and fatigue.

Pair your magnesium intake with Vitamin B6. B6 acts as a cofactor, enhancing magnesium's absorption and utilization in the cells, especially beneficial for stress reduction and energy metabolism.

Consider transdermal magnesium (e.g., magnesium flakes in a bath) for localized muscle soreness or general relaxation, especially if oral supplements cause digestive upset.

If you're an endurance athlete prone to electrolyte imbalance, choose magnesium forms like magnesium citrate or malate, which also support energy cycles and can be less harsh on the gut than some other forms.

Be mindful of other supplements: high doses of zinc can compete with magnesium for absorption. Space out intake or adjust dosages accordingly.

For optimal recovery, integrate magnesium into your post-training routine alongside protein and carbohydrates. It's not just about muscle repair but also nervous system recovery.
